ECA May Membership Meeting - May 13, 2020

Membership Meeting was a Webinar with two guest presenters.

May 13, 2020

The Electrical Contractors’ Association of City of Chicago (ECA) held its May Membership Meeting on Wednesday, May 13, 2020 as a Webinar. The program featured industry updates, and guest presentations from Josh Bone, NECA Director, Industry Innovation and Lonnie Cumpton, NECA Director, Construction Manufacturing.

Josh Bone

For more than two decades Josh Bone has been implementing, training and presenting construction technology solutions to AEC&O (Architecture, Engineering, Construction, Owners) professionals. Having worked with some of the top technology leaders in the industry, Josh specializes in identifying best practices and methodologies for integrating construction technology into everyday workflows. Today he works with NECA as the Director of Industry Innovation where he is helping drive technology adoption within their member companies. Josh has had the opportunity to share his knowledge with audiences and publications across North America as a frequent professional speaker and guest editorial contributor. Josh is also a frequent host on The ConTech Crew podcast. 

Josh Bone’s Presentation Highlights

"Why it’s time to Embrace Tech in Construction":

New technology can be perceived as a threat to some construction professionals while the same technology is viewed as a new opportunity to others in our industry. Where do you stand today and how can you change your perspective to see new opportunities when they arise? In this talk Josh covered how new technologies are changing the way projects are designed and constructed presenting us with new challenges and opportunities throughout the entire building life cycle. Participants learned how you can diversify your business and transition your company from a commodity to a consultant.

Learning Objectives:

  1. Identify new opportunities that are arising from new technologies in the construction industry.
  2. Discuss the difference in how individuals perceive change.
  3. Explore new methods of challenging ourselves to embrace change.
  4. Understand how all the rapid change that is occurring in construction is impacting us in our own roles.


Lonnie Cumpton

Over the past 28+ years Lonnie Cumpton has been innovating in the building design and construction industry by following an integration method of people, process and then technology. Currently Mr. Cumpton is the Director of Construction Manufacturing at NECA ( National Electrical Contractors Association). Prior to his February 10, 2020 start date at NECA, Cumpton worked as the Virtual Construction Technology Manager for Faith Technologies at its corporate headquarters in Menasha, Wisconsin. He also served as Director of BIM Technologies at Taylor Design in Irvine, California. He has been featured in publications such as Architectural Evangelist, CIO Review, AUGIWorld and Design Intelligence and in public speaking engagements at Autodesk University, Revit Technology Conference, Bluebeam Extreme, CONTECH Roadshows and The CONTECH Crew podcast.

Lonnie Cumpton's Presentation Highlights

Positioning your business for Off-Site Construction:

Electrical Contractors of all sizes and in all regions are being impacted by the skilled labor shortage found throughout the construction industry. When you compare the predictions of population growth and it’s required needs for all types of buildings, against the growth numbers for skilled labor, it is actually scary. In this session Lonnie asked and discussed the question, "Is your business positioned to take advantage of the benefits of off-site construction?"

Learning Objectives:

  • Define Off-Site Construction, Pre-Fab and Construction Manufacturing.
  • Identify the off-site construction trends and how your company can incorporate them.
  • Explore the topic of Buy vs. Build
